I am probably not your average user (if there is such a thing ;-)), but
I'll throw in my $ 0.02 ...
Myself and the project I am working on, use ISO-, PXE-, SYS- and since
recently also EXTLINUX.
ISO, PXE and SYS for obvious reasons (no viable alternatives) to be able
to boot from CD-ROM, PXE, and USB stick.
I stopped using grub (legacy) because I could not get it to fully work
with software RAID. Now this may well be because of stupidity on my
side, but with EXTLINUX "it just worked". And it also worked within
minutes, closely reading the wiki sufficed.
What I like about SYSLINUX (and companions) is that it is all fairly
easy to use, relatively small and comes with excellent support. All
features I hope will remain for a long time.
